Solve the inequality. Graph your solution.

3y-5<2(17-5y)

Solution of the inequality is y<3.

Step by step solution

01

Step 1. Solve the inequality

3y-5<2(17-5y)

Use the distributive property.

3y-5<34-10y

Add 5 and 10y on both the sides.

3y5+5+10y<3410y+10y+513y<39

Divide both sides by 13.

y<3913y<3

02

Step 2. Graph the inequality

The solution of the inequality is y<3.

That means, all values y<3 satisfy the inequality. So, the graph can be given as shown below.

03

Step 3. Check the solution

To check the solution, take any random number, y<3 and substitute in the original inequality and observe the result.

Take b=0.

Then,

3×05<2(175×0)05<21705<34

The result -5<34 is true. So, the solution y<3 is correct.
